Ventilator Stress Assistance: What You Need to Know for Ideal Person Care

Ventilator stress support (VPS) refers to a mode of mechanical air flow where the ventilator helps the client's spontaneous breaths by giving a predetermined level of inspiratory pressure. This approach is developed mainly for clients who have some ability to initiate breaths however call for support as a result of damaged breathing muscle mass or various other underlying conditions.

The Essentials of Ventilator Stress Support

What Is Ventilator Support?

Ventilator assistance incorporates different methods utilized by medical care experts to aid clients needing respiratory system help. This includes VPS, Continuous Positive Air Passage Pressure (CPAP), and Assist-Control (AIR CONDITIONER) modes among others.

How Does VPS Work?

When an individual launches a breathing initiative, the ventilator finds this activity thanks to its delicate triggers. It then delivers a preset amount of pressure during inspiration, guaranteeing that the client gets enough air flow without having to function exceedingly hard.

Key Components of VPS

Pressure Settings: The degree at which the ventilator assists the patient's breath. Trigger Sensitivity: The responsiveness of the ventilator in finding individual efforts. Cycle Termination: The standards utilized by the ventilator to establish when motivation must end. PEEP (Positive End Expiratory Pressure): Maintains respiratory tract patency and avoids alveolar collapse at end-expiration.

Indications for Making use of Ventilator Stress Support

When Is VPS Indicated?

VPS is shown in a number of scientific scenarios:

    Chronic Obstructive Lung Illness (COPD) exacerbations Neuromuscular problems impacting breathing muscles Post-operative people needing momentary support Patients with serious pneumonia or ARDS (Acute Respiratory Distress Disorder)

Advantages and Drawbacks of VPS

Benefits of Ventilator Pressure Support

Improved Comfort: People often locate VPS more comfy than traditional intrusive ventilation. Reduced Sedation Needs: Lots of people are able to comply far better during treatment. Preservation of Respiratory Muscle mass Function: Allows some level of spontaneous effort. Easier Weaning Process: Steady reduction in support promotes weaning off mechanical ventilation.

Potential Drawbacks

Risk of Hyperventilation: Inappropriate settings might bring about extreme ventilation. Patient-Ventilator Asynchrony: Mismatch between client demands and device responses can trigger discomfort. Increased Workload if Not Kept Track Of Properly: Needs continuous assessment by experienced professionals.
